From b45ccfd25d506e83d9ecf93d0ac7edf031d35d2f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Chuck Lever Date: Wed, 28 May 2014 10:32:34 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] xprtrdma: Remove MEMWINDOWS registration modes The MEMWINDOWS and MEMWINDOWS_ASYNC memory registration modes were intended as stop-gap modes before the introduction of FRMR. They are now considered obsolete. MEMWINDOWS_ASYNC is also considered unsafe because it can leave client memory registered and exposed for an indeterminant time after each I/O. At this point, the MEMWINDOWS modes add needless complexity, so remove them. Signed-off-by: Chuck Lever Tested-by: Steve Wise Signed-off-by: Anna Schumaker --- Reading git-format-patch failed
